In a trapezoid, the length of the median (also known as the midsegment) is calculated as the average of the lengths of the two bases. The bases in this case are the segments on the top and bottom of the trapezoid.

The top base length is represented as \(19\) and the bottom base length is represented as \(21\).

To find the length of the median (M) of the trapezoid, we use the formula:

\[ M = \frac{\text{Base}_1 + \text{Base}_2}{2} \]

Substituting the values for the bases:

\[ M = \frac{19 + 21}{2} = \frac{40}{2} = 20 \]

Therefore, the length of the median of the trapezoid is \(20\).

The answer is 20.
